WebSSDs can overheat, however, for a regular SATA SSD, it is unlikely in a case with good airflow. The metal casing the SATA SSD features will work as a built-in heatsink and will … WebAug 20, 2014 · I replaced my old HDD with a new SSD recently. NVMe SSD’s that … WebAdata, Crucial, Samsung, Sabrent Rocket and WD Blue all do great drives. For normal use, over heating shouldn't be an issue. They don't usually overheat unless in a high load scenario with poor airflow. That would be something like in an M.2 slot on the back of a motherboard, and copying like 100+ GB to it sequentially.
